Food Services Manager - Higher Ed. jobs in Waterloo, IA

Food Services Manager - Higher Ed. manages and coordinates food service, menu planning, and dining hall management for a university/college. Arranges work schedules and trains food service workers. Being a Food Services Manager - Higher Ed. maintains equipment and ensures kitchen sanitation. May require a bachelor's degree. Additionally, Food Services Manager - Higher Ed. typically reports to a head of a unit/department. The Food Services Manager - Higher Ed. supervises a group of primarily para-professional level staffs. May also be a level above a supervisor within high volume administrative/ production environments. Makes day-to-day decisions within or for a group/small department. Has some authority for personnel actions. Thorough knowledge of department processes. To be a Food Services Manager - Higher Ed. typically requires 3-5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    About the Job:

    The responsibilities of the Transportation Manager include, but are not limited to, the following:

    · Responsible for the oversight and scheduling of fleet maintenance for all Food Bank vehicles. Utilize UpKeep to maintain proper record keeping and reporting of all required documentation. Correspond with the Warehouse Supervisor in order to reduce any negative impact on daily operations.

    · Oversee NEIFB drivers and verify that each vehicle is properly checked before operation.

    · Develop and retain vendor relationships to secure competitive pricing and ensure quick turnaround on maintenance.

    · Make deliveries to local agencies and partners, ensuring food safety standards are met and providing outstanding customer service. Complete required documentation.

    · Oversee the development of efficient routes and driver schedules to reduce labor costs as well as strategies for greater fuel efficiency and reduced vehicle costs.

    · Perform retail food rescue pick-up route with refrigerated truck and collect donations from our partner retailers for the Food Bank. Maintain food safety standards, accurately track donation sources and maintain professional relationships with donors. Communicate challenges and opportunities to the Community Food Connections Coordinator and the Food Sourcing Manager.

    · Maintain fuel levels and required cleanliness of all vehicles. Periodically audit vehicles for following fuel and cleanliness guidelines in order to keep the operations team accountable.

    · Assist with the implementation of maintenance management software, GPS systems, logistics and routing software to monitor drivers, optimize routes, track fleet maintenance and repairs, minimize downtime and improve operational efficiency.

    · Deliver and unload product at mobile pantry sites. Maintain professional relationships with volunteers and coordinators. Communicate challenges and opportunities to the Community Programs team.

    · Perform donor pickups at food manufacturers and processors throughout the state of Iowa.

    · Keep up to date with and guarantee compliance with U.S. Department of Transportation laws and regulations.

    · Assist with warehouse operations including accurate and efficient order fulfillment, precise inventory counts and routine cleaning.

    · Greet, train and supervise volunteers as well as share the mission of the NEIFB; provide general guidance of projects; assure proper training of volunteers to include specific jobs and safety concerns. Communicate frequently with volunteers to ensure they are satisfied and appropriately placed.

    · In instances of a federal, state or locally declared emergency, NEIFB is typically considered an essential service and emergency responder; all of its employees may be called in to perform regular or emergent duties.

    · Provide occasional coverage in other areas of the NEIFB, as necessary, in times of high need.

Waterloo is a city in and the county seat of Black Hawk County, Iowa, United States. As of the 2010 United States Census the population decreased by 0.5% to 68,406; the 2016 Census estimates the population at 67,934, making it the sixth-largest city in the state. The city is part of the Waterloo – Cedar Falls Metropolitan Statistical Area, and is the more populous of the two cities. According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 63.23 square miles (163.76 km2), of which 61.39 square miles (159.00 km2) is land and 1.84 square miles (4.77 km2) is water.
